Transaction 7782d64b94b489abda14a2dd62756ddf709101e97311626a14eeb84713137819
1 Input
2 Outputs
- 7782d64b94b489abda14a2dd62756ddf709101e97311626a14eeb84713137819:0
- 7782d64b94b489abda14a2dd62756ddf709101e97311626a14eeb84713137819:1
value 100000
address 1Fr2ShW4v51SfvWr8nDmTpwu2pM63e5bTn
value 1113970
address 1LS9vC5LQrMG4Yg5jbgttLN825g4ujKqDg